History

The tavern was founded by Kiri Bellsmoke, a retired half-elf ranger, and her wife, Tekka Mosscup, a retired human fighter. They bought the building after their final expedition and named it for the constant clatter of stools, cups, boots, and dice within. During their adventuring years, they unknowingly carried a small mimic with them from one dungeon to the next. It hid as a traveling stool, a camp chest, a saddle seat, and once, disastrously, a chamber pot. They assumed it was an unusually durable piece of gear.

Quirks

The tavern is loud even when nobody is speaking. Floorboards creak in different rhythms, tankards rattle when the hearth flares, and the bar's hanging ladles knock together whenever someone lies. One stool, Stump's usual form, is slightly warmer than the others and always seems to end up near the person most likely to cause trouble. The owners casually scold it as though it were a badly behaved dog. Every morning, they find a neat little pile of dead vermin behind the kitchen door, though neither admits to knowing how it gets there.

Lore

The Clatterstool is known as a safe gathering place for adventurers, caravan guards, dock laborers, and mercenaries between jobs. Its owners have a practical rule: no killing indoors, no magic used to win at gambling, and no insulting the staff unless the insulter is prepared to buy the next round. The tavern's hidden protector has become a quiet local legend. Patrons say that rats vanish from the walls, stolen purses sometimes reappear beneath the bar, and a particular stool has thrown more than one drunkard onto the floor. In truth, Stump is a friendly mimic with the instincts of a house cat and the appetite of a dungeon predator.
